Abstract:  

To achieve oper­a­tional integri­ty, com­pa­nies need access to dif­fer­ent types of data to improve deci­sions at the point of work exe­cu­tion.  Most oil and gas com­pa­nies inte­grate some data sources, but lack a true con­nect­ed assets’ plat­form to effec­tive­ly inte­grate data sources togeth­er.  They work around this lim­i­ta­tion by per­form­ing inspec­tions, gath­er­ing infor­ma­tion on spread­sheets and review­ing read­ings on pumps and valves.  This process takes a lot of time and effort and lim­its their abil­i­ty to improve per­for­mance across the plant or on the rig. This process is chang­ing, as new­er plat­forms and soft­ware eas­i­ly inte­grate data sources; enabling oper­a­tions with insight and alerts spec­i­fy­ing degra­da­tion in equip­ment before they fail, so that actions can be tak­en to min­i­mize downtime.

This pre­sen­ta­tion will pro­vide insight on the chal­lenges fac­ing the O&G indus­try in the area of con­nect­ed assets and how devel­op­ing a dig­i­tal trans­for­ma­tion ini­tia­tive can change think­ing to dri­ve val­ue across the enter­prise.  Exam­ples of suc­cess­ful cus­tomer ini­tia­tives will be dis­cussed, to show how some com­pa­nies are start­ing down the path of change, using tech­nol­o­gy com­bined with busi­ness process change to opti­mize oper­a­tions.  By devel­op­ing an enter­prise trans­for­ma­tion plan, O&G com­pa­nies can adjust to dynam­ic changes occur­ring in their indus­try and suc­cess­ful­ly nav­i­gate the hype cycles dri­ven by tech­nol­o­gy to improve deci­sions, process­es and ulti­mate­ly, operations.
